I think the problem could be that your hardware driver has not been compiled.
If you are using an existing board supported by eCos, and are using the net template of the board, then it must be something else.

Can you better discribe all of it.

First try to make RedBoot running.
Enable all networking debugging and check it at the serial output.
To see all network options, look through your ecos.ecc file made at compilation:
- CYGPKG_NET_FREEBSD_LOGGING, CYGPKG_NET_DEBUG, CYGDBG_NET_SHOW_MBUFS; for debugging in general: CYGPKG_INFRA_DEBUG, CYGDBG_INFRA_DEBUG_TRACE_ASSERT_FANCY
- in redboot you can enable network debugging as an option with fconfig
